How to Treat Contact Dermatitis From Gel Nail Polish

Contact dermatitis is an inflammatory skin reaction that occurs when the skin comes into direct contact with an irritating substance or an allergen. When associated with gel nail polish, this condition often stems from specific chemical ingredients within the polish. This guide provides information on identifying, treating, and preventing such reactions.

Identifying the Allergic Reaction

An allergic reaction to gel nail polish typically manifests with noticeable symptoms on the skin around the nails, on the fingertips, or even on other body parts touched by the uncured product. Common signs include redness, intense itching, and swelling of the nail folds and surrounding skin. Blistering, peeling, or flaking of the skin are also frequent indicators of this allergic response.

These reactions can emerge at different times following exposure to the gel polish. Some individuals might experience symptoms immediately after application, while for others, the reaction could develop hours or even days later. The primary culprits in gel nail polish formulations responsible for causing these allergic responses are often acrylates and methacrylates, particularly chemicals like hydroxyethyl methacrylate (HEMA) and di-HEMA trimethylhexyl dicarbamate (di-HEMA TMHDC). These monomers, while essential for the curing process of gel polish, are known sensitizers that can trigger an immune response in susceptible individuals.

Immediate Relief and Home Remedies

When an allergic reaction to gel nail polish is suspected, the first step involves safely removing the gel polish if it is still on the nails. This can help minimize further exposure to the allergen and allow the skin to begin healing. After removal, gently clean the affected area with mild soap and lukewarm water to remove any lingering irritants. Applying cool compresses to the inflamed skin can help reduce swelling and provide immediate soothing relief from itching and discomfort.

Several over-the-counter (OTC) remedies can offer relief for mild to moderate symptoms. Applying a thick layer of petrolatum jelly or a fragrance-free moisturizer can create a protective barrier on the skin, aiding in moisture retention and supporting the skin’s natural healing process. For persistent itching and inflammation, a mild topical hydrocortisone cream can be applied sparingly to the affected areas for a few days. Avoid scratching the irritated skin, as this can worsen inflammation and potentially introduce bacteria. Also, refrain from using harsh soaps, abrasive scrubs, or other potential irritants on the affected skin during the healing period.

Professional Medical Treatments

Seek professional medical advice if symptoms of contact dermatitis from gel nail polish are severe, persistent, or show signs of complications like intense swelling, unmanageable pain, or infection (pus, increasing redness, warmth). Consulting a healthcare professional is also advisable if home care measures do not lead to significant improvement within a few days, or if the rash spreads.

A dermatologist can provide an accurate diagnosis and recommend more potent treatments. They might prescribe stronger topical corticosteroids, which are more effective at reducing severe inflammation and itching than over-the-counter options. For widespread or very severe allergic reactions, oral corticosteroids, such as prednisone, may be prescribed to suppress the immune response and alleviate symptoms systemically. Oral antihistamines can also be recommended to help manage intense itching. Patch testing, performed by a dermatologist, can identify the specific allergens responsible, which is a valuable step for preventing future reactions.

Preventing Future Allergic Reactions

Preventing future allergic reactions to gel nail polish involves careful product selection and diligent application practices. One effective measure is to perform a patch test with any new gel polish product before a full application. This involves applying a small amount of the product to a discreet area of skin, such as the inner arm or behind the ear, and observing for any reaction over 48 to 72 hours.

Choosing “HEMA-free” or “hypoallergenic” gel polishes can significantly reduce the risk of allergic reactions, as HEMA and di-HEMA TMHDC are common sensitizers. Always ensure proper application techniques, which includes avoiding direct contact of the uncured gel polish with the skin around the nails. Using protective gloves during application, especially for nail technicians or individuals who frequently apply polish, can also create a barrier against potential allergens. Carefully reading product labels to identify ingredients known to cause sensitivity, such as acrylates and methacrylates, is also a proactive step in preventing future occurrences.
